Raven McTaggart is Crowned Miss Global International 2025 as Cayman hosts prestigious pageant for second consecutive year. 

Cayman is celebrating big on the world stage as for the first time ever, the Cayman Islands has brought home an international crown.   Miss Global International Cayman Islands, Raven McTaggart, was crowned Miss Global International 2025 during the glittering finals held on October 4th, 2025, Grand Cayman.  The pageant, hosted in the Cayman Islands for the second consecutive year, showcased beauty, culture, and empowerment in an atmosphere of elegance and pride at the beautiful Azzure Ballroom at the Hotel Indigo.

It was a night filled with grace and glamour where reginal queens from across the globe came together to compete for the top title of Miss Global International 2025.  Nabbing the First Runner Up title went to Miss Global International Mexico, Fernanda Suarez, followed by, Kaila Enriquez, Miss Global International Canada who claimed the Second Runner-Up slot.  Following right behind in a very tight race was Miss Global International Barbados, Tia Browne as Third Runner-Up, with Miss Global International USA, Natasha Lee finishing as the Fourth Runner-Up.

Passing on the crown and visiting the beautiful Cayman Islands was none other than Miss Global International 2024, Arian Richmond of Guyana who reminisced about how it felt for her this time last year when she and 18 other delegates were on their journey to the crown.  “It was nerve wracking and magical all at the same time and I was so relieved when it was finally over”, Richmond had to say.  She warmly crowned the new queen amid cheers and applause from a very supportive audience that came out to cheer on the Cayman Islands as well as all of the overseas queens.

Special Category awards were presented on the evening to:

Miss Congeniality: Miss Global International United Kingdom Cheniel Henderson

Best National Costume: Miss Global International Mexico, Fernanda Suarez

Best in Interview: Miss Global International Barbados, Tia Browne

Best in Gown: Miss Global International Cayman, Raven McTaggart

People’s Choice Award: Miss Global International Jamaica USA, Jodiann Pagan

Best Talent: Miss Global International Cayman, Raven McTaggart

Miss Photogenic: Miss Global International Cayman, Raven McTaggart

What makes Miss Global International unique is that each delegate comes already with a crown from her country and hence goes back with her crown to continue her reign for the rest of the year.  Miss Global International Pageant is in its 21st year having been established in 2013, by Mr Lachman Ramchandani of Montego Bay, Jamaica.  The event once again placed the Cayman Islands in the international spotlight, blending the spirit of global unity with the warmth and hospitality for which the islands are known. MGI welcomes women aged 17 to 40, including married women and mothers, reflecting inclusivity and modern womanhood.
